Bandwidth and cost management for ad hoc networks
First Claim
Patent Images
1. A method comprising:
- receiving, by at least one computer system, sensor data provided from a plurality of sensors;
constructing, by the at least one computer system, an ad hoc network among the plurality of sensors based on at least a portion of the received sensor data;
performing, by the at least one computer system, an analysis of bandwidth information associated with each sensor in a group of sensors in the ad hoc network; and
determining the at least one computer system, a manner in which at least one sensor in the group exchanges data based on the analysis of the bandwidth information.
9 Assignments
0 Petitions
Accused Products
Abstract
A system and method is described herein for managing bandwidth and cost in connection with a plurality of sensors in an ad hoc network. The system and method receives sensor data that is provided from a plurality of sensors and constructs an ad hoc network among the plurality of sensors based on the sensor data. The system and method also receives and analyzes bandwidth information from each sensor in a group of sensors in the ad hoc network. Based on the analysis, the system and method then modifies a manner in which at least one sensor in the group exchanges data, including sensor data and multimedia content.
70 Citations
49 Claims
-
1. A method comprising:
-
receiving, by at least one computer system, sensor data provided from a plurality of sensors; constructing, by the at least one computer system, an ad hoc network among the plurality of sensors based on at least a portion of the received sensor data; performing, by the at least one computer system, an analysis of bandwidth information associated with each sensor in a group of sensors in the ad hoc network; and determining the at least one computer system, a manner in which at least one sensor in the group exchanges data based on the analysis of the bandwidth information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. A system, comprising:
at least one computing system providing; a communications manager configured to receive sensor data provided from a plurality of sensors; a bandwidth tracking manager configured to construct an ad hoc network among the plurality of sensors based on at least a portion of the received sensor data; and a bandwidth management manager configured to perform an analysis of bandwidth information associated with each sensor in a group of sensors in the ad hoc network and to determine a manner in which at least one sensor in the group exchanges data based on the analysis of the bandwidth information.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
34. A computer program product comprising a computer-readable non-transitory storage medium having computer program code tangibly recorded thereon for enabling a processing unit to manage bandwidth in an ad hoc network, the computer program code comprising:
-
code to enable the processing unit to receive sensor data provided from a plurality of sensors; code to enable the processing unit to construct an ad hoc network among the plurality of sensors based on at least a portion of the received sensor data; and code to enable the processing unit to perform an analysis of bandwidth information associated with each sensor in a group of sensors in the ad hoc network; and code to enable the processing unit to determine a manner in which at least one sensor in the group exchanges data based on the analysis of the bandwidth information. - View Dependent Claims (35, 36, 37, 38, 39, 40, 41, 42, 43, 44, 45, 46, 47, 48, 49)
-
Specification